About Us

Berry Jane™ is a swimwear and activewear brand based in the US, which was founded in 2007 and officially launched in 2010. Our collection features beachwear, swimwear, and active apparel perfect for water sports such as paddle boarding, surfing, swimming, or yoga. Since our inception, we have grown into a lifestyle brand that empowers women to get moving and enjoy the activities they love, without being distracted by their swimsuit. Our products are ethically made in America, and we take pride in offering sweatshop-free and sustainable collections.

Sustainable Fashion

At Berry Jane™, we are committed to creating sustainable and eco-friendly products that support US manufacturing and locally sourced materials. Our mission is to provide women with high-quality swimwear that is both stylish and environmentally conscious, while promoting sustainable practices throughout our supply chain.

We believe in the importance of not only using eco-friendly fabrics, such as recycled materials and organic cotton, to reduce our environmental impact, but manufacturing less to avoid waste. That is why 90% of our garments are made when our customers order. We are dedicated to sourcing our materials locally whenever possible, supporting our local communities and reducing transportation emissions.

In addition, we are committed to manufacturing our products in America and USA, providing fair wages and safe working conditions for our employees. By doing so, we aim to support American manufacturing and reduce our carbon footprint.

Our goal is to empower women to feel confident and comfortable in their swimwear while making a positive impact on the environment. We will continue to innovate and improve our practices to ensure that we are always contributing to a more sustainable future.

About Our Logo

Our *Berry Jane™ logo was created as an upside-down triangle with 6 circles. What does it mean?

  • Circles: The circle symbol meaning is universal, sacred and divine. It represents the infinite nature of energy and the inclusivity of the universe. (Yes, it also looks like berries!)
  • Upside Down Triangle: The upside down triangle is female, lunar, symbolizing feminine or Mother.
  • The Number 6: Six is connected with balance, responsibility, and love. Life Path Number 6 has a lot of energy of service in it. It holds the harmony between the macrocosms and microcosms. The 6 life path number is "love toward others in order to exist for others."

Meet the Founder

Ava Carmichael is the visionary founder and designer behind Berry Jane. Ava is not only a highly accomplished designer but also a serial entrepreneur and marketing professional with an insatiable appetite for exploring new strategies and technologies.

Originally from Texas, Ava has lived far and wide, immersing herself in the vibrant cultures of cities like Los Angeles, New York and Denver.

Ava's remarkable journey in the fashion industry began in 1998, when she began designing swimwear. Over time, her passion evolved, leading her to focus on denim and collaborate with renowned apparel companies, fine-tuning her skills and craftsmanship.

In 2009, Ava took a bold step by launching Berry Jane, a spirited children's wear brand. It quickly blossomed into a flourishing line that now encompasses women's and kids' activewear and swimwear.
